Biography

Dr. Ben Rothwell is an Assistant Professor of Medicine and Pediatrics at the Tulane University School of Medicine and the co-director of the Tulane Simulation Center. He received his Bachelor of Science Degree from the University of Utah where he studied Biological Chemistry. Dr. Rothwell matriculated to Tulane University School of Medicine where he received his medical doctorate. He went on to complete a residency in Internal Medicine and Pediatrics at Baystate Medical Center in Springfield, Massachusetts. Following the completion of his residency training in 2008, he returned to Tulane University School of Medicine as an academic hospitalist.

Interests:

His clinical interests include medical education, point of care ultrasound training, and nutrition.
